Introduction to Robot Vacuum Cleaners with Mops
Robot vacuum with mops, typically described as "mop vacuums" or "mopping robotics," are smart cleaning gadgets designed to deal with both vacuuming and mopping tasks. These robots use innovative navigation and cleaning technologies to move homes, cleaning floors and mopping as they go. They are especially advantageous for homes with hectic way of lives, as they can run independently and on a schedule, guaranteeing that floorings are always tidy without the need for manual intervention.

Secret Features of Robot Vacuum Cleaners with Mops
Dual Cleaning Functions
- Vacuuming: Equipped with effective suction, these robotics can successfully get rid of dirt, dust, and particles from numerous floor types, including wood, tile, and carpet.
- Mopping: Many models feature a mopping system that can be activated individually or in conjunction with the vacuuming function, using microfiber pads or special mopping options to clean and polish floors.
Advanced Navigation Systems
- Lidar Technology: Some models use Lidar (Light Detection and Ranging) to develop a precise map of the home, allowing them to navigate efficiently and avoid challenges.
- Visual Navigation: Others use electronic cameras and visual markers to map and navigate their environment, making sure thorough and constant cleaning.
Connectivity and Smart Features
- App Control: Most robot vacuum with mops can be managed via a mobile phone app, enabling users to arrange cleanings, display progress, and change settings remotely.
- Voice Commands: Integration with smart home ass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ant enables users to manage the robot hoover and mop with voice commands, including another layer of benefit.
Adjustable Cleaning Modes
- Area Cleaning: For localized messes, spot cleaning modes focus on a specific area.
- Edge Cleaning: These modes guarantee that the robot can clean along walls and in corners, where dirt and dust often accumulate.
- Set up Cleaning: Users can set the robot to clean at specific times, making sure that the home is constantly tidy without manual effort.
Maintenance and Convenience
- Self-Cleaning Station: Some models come with a self-cleaning station that instantly clears the dust bin and cleans up the mop pad, lowering the requirement for frequent manual maintenance.
- Changeable and Washable Filters: Most robots have filters that can be easily changed or washed, making sure ideal efficiency with time.

Practical Considerations
Floor Type Compatibility
- Difficult Floors: Robot vacuum cleaners with mops are especially effective on hard floors like wood, marble, and tile.
- Carpets: While many designs can deal with low-pile carpets, they might not appropriate for high-pile or shag carpets.
Obstacle Avoidance
- Furniture: Ensure that furnishings is set up in a manner that enables the robot to move freely.
- Cables and Small Objects: Keep cable televisions and small items out of the robot cleaner with mop's path to prevent entanglement and damage.
Battery Life
- Charge Time: Most robotics have a battery life of 1.5 to 3 hours and can return to their charging dock when the battery is low.
- Cleaning Time: The battery life will figure out how much location the robot can clean in one session.
Noise Level
- Quiet Operation: Many designs are created to run silently, making them ideal for usage throughout the day or in the evening.
- Mopping Noise: Some users discover the mopping function to be somewhat louder than vacuuming, but it is usually not disruptive.
Water Management
- Managed Flow: Ensure that the robot's water management system is well-calibrated to avoid water damage to floors.
- Auto-Emptying: Models with self-cleaning stations often have functions to immediately empty the water tank, reducing the need for manual refills.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: Are robot vacuum with mops appropriate for all floor types?
- A: While they are highly effective on hard floorings, their performance on carpets can vary. Low-pile carpets are normally fine, but high-pile carpets might not appropriate. Always examine the producer's recommendations for the very best automatic vacuum floor types.
Q: How often should I clean the robot's filters and mop pads?
- A: Filters must be cleaned or changed every few weeks, depending upon use. Mop pads need to be cleaned after each mopping session to prevent the buildup of dirt and bacteria.
Q: Can I utilize these robotics with pets?
- A: Yes, numerous designs are created to manage pet hair and dander efficiently. Search for robotics with strong suction and specialized pet cleaning modes.
Q: How do I establish the robot vacuum cleaner with mop?
- A: Most models feature user-friendly setup directions. Typically, you need to charge the robot, link it to your Wi-Fi network, and utilize the app to establish cleaning schedules and personalize settings.
Q: What should I do if the robot gets stuck?
- A: If the robot gets stuck, you can typically save it by raising it out of the challenge. Some designs have integrated sensing units that will pause the cleaning and go back to the charging dock if they experience a problem.
